Four cops injured in explosion in KP’s Lakki Marwat

Published on: April 2, 2026 3:13 AM

Four cops were injured in an explosion in the Serai Naurang town of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a’s Lakki Marwat district on Wednesday, according to police.

District police spokesperson Qudratullah Khan told Dawn that the explosion occurred on the busy Bannu-DI Khan Road near a fruit and vegetable market.

He said that according to initial information, the attackers targeted a police patrol party from the Shaheed Asmatullah Khan Khattak police station.

The spokesperson said Head Constable Waheedullah and Constables Syed Anwar, Hadiullah and Ikramullah were injured in the explosion.

He said that the van the police party had been patrolling in was also damaged in the explosion.

The exact nature and cause of the explosion are yet to be determined. Police have not commented on the nature of the explosion, but local residents attribute it to an explosive device, which they said was fitted on a motorcycle.

They also said that some shops and vehicles that were parked near the site of the incident had also been damaged in the explosion.

Separately, security forces killed Khwarij terrorists belonging to Indian Proxy Fitna Al Khwarij in two separate engagements in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a (KPK) Province.

“On reported presence of Khwarij, an intelligence-based operation was conducted by the Security Forces in the general area Bara, Khyber District.

During the conduct of operation, own troops effectively engaged khwarijs’ location and after an intense fire exchange, ten Khwarijs were sent to hell,” said a news release issued by Inter Services Public Relations (ISPR).

Another intelligence-based operation was conducted by Security forces in Bannu District. In the ensuing fire exchange, three khwarij were effectively neutralised.

“Sanitization operations are being conducted to eliminate any other Indian-sponsored kharji found in the area, as the relentless Counter Terrorism campaign under vision “Azm-e-Istehkam” (as approved by the Federal Apex Committee on National Action Plan) by Security Forces and Law Enforcement Agencies of Pakistan will continue at full pace to wipe out the menace of foreign-sponsored and supported terrorism from the country,” the news release said.

President Asif Ali Zardari and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if on Wednesday paid tribute to the security forces for successful operations against Fitna al Khawarij terrorists in the Khyber and Bannu districts of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, in which 13 terrorists were killed.

In separate statements, the president and the prime minister expressed their unwavering resolve to completely eradicate terrorism from the country.

President Zardari stated that operations against terrorists, backed by external elements, must continue to ensure national security and the protection of citizens.

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if said that the security forces were standing like an iron wall against terrorism to safeguard the country.
